BrowserStealer 项目使用教程
1. 项目介绍
BrowserStealer 是一个用于从各种浏览器(包括 Chrome、Microsoft Edge、Firefox 等)中提取密码、cookies、历史记录和书签的工具。该项目支持所有基于 Chromium 和 Gecko 的浏览器,并且可以找到非标准位置的 Firefox 安装。所有 WinAPI 调用都进行了混淆处理,支持基于 Chromium 和 Gecko 的浏览器,并且可以在 64 位系统上运行。
2. 项目快速启动
2.1 克隆项目
首先,克隆 BrowserStealer 项目到本地:
git clone https://github.com/SaulBerrenson/BrowserStealer.git
2.2 构建项目
进入项目目录并构建项目:
cd BrowserStealer
mkdir build
cd build
cmake ..
make
2.3 运行项目
构建完成后,运行生成的可执行文件:
./BrowserStealer
3. 应用案例和最佳实践
3.1 应用案例
BrowserStealer 可以用于安全测试和漏洞分析,帮助安全研究人员了解浏览器的安全性。例如,可以通过提取浏览器的密码和 cookies 来测试网站的安全性,确保用户数据不会轻易被窃取。
3.2 最佳实践
- 安全测试:在受控环境中使用 BrowserStealer 进行安全测试,确保不会对用户数据造成损害。
- 数据备份:定期备份浏览器数据,以便在需要时恢复。
- 权限管理:确保只有授权人员可以访问和使用 BrowserStealer。
4. 典型生态项目
4.1 相关项目
- Chromium:一个开源的浏览器项目,BrowserStealer 支持所有基于 Chromium 的浏览器。
- Firefox:一个开源的浏览器项目,BrowserStealer 支持所有基于 Gecko 的浏览器。
- Microsoft Edge:基于 Chromium 的浏览器,BrowserStealer 也支持。
4.2 生态系统
BrowserStealer 作为一个工具,可以与其他安全工具和浏览器项目结合使用,形成一个完整的安全生态系统。例如,可以与漏洞扫描工具结合,进行更全面的安全测试。
通过以上步骤,您可以快速启动并使用 BrowserStealer 项目,同时了解其在安全测试中的应用和最佳实践。